Today’s show features Mark Newhouse author of  The Devil’s Bookkeepers, which won the Grand Prize Fiction Series and First Prize Hemingway Wartime Series awards in the Chanticleer International Book Awards, the Gold Medal Historical Fiction, and Book of the Year in the Florida Writers Association’s Royal Palm Literary Awards, and Book 3 won 1st Prize Historical Fiction, Eric Hoffer awards. Mark taught on Long Island, which inspired his award-winning children’s mysteries, Welcome to Monstrovia, and its sequels. 

Mark is the founding President of Writers League of The Villages, ‘Top Cat’ of Writers 4 Kids, he writes the Village Neighbors magazine Writing Bug column and is the Youth Chairperson and a Florida Writers Association Director.

He will tell us about what inspired him to write The Devil’s Bookkeepers? The Devil’s Bookkeepers is unique among Holocaust books. He will address how the book is impacting readers and how this book about the Holocaust is relevant today.

He will talk about turning his book into a movie or series for TV.
